Did we mention that Long Beach State is the most improved team in the country? Yes, we did but pipe down. They are 8-1 their last nine and 11-3 the last 14.

Since the arrival of Travis Hammonds and Tyler Lamb, the 49ers have turned things around after a 1-9 start. Defensively, the team has been competitive, making the team's offensive output the key to victory. The key number is shooting 35%; Since Dec. 19, the team is 11-1 when passing that number while going 0-4 when shooting under that mark. The only loss when shooting over that mark came against UCSB on a buzzer-beater.

Tyler Lamb, a junior transfer from UCLA, became eligible for the 49ers on December 19, and has immediately had a huge impact. Lamb scored 20 points off of the bench against USC, helping the 49ers earn their first win over a Pac-12 opponent at home since 1999 in a 72-71 win. Lamb has scored in double-figures in 13 of the 16 games he's played with the 49ers, and is averaging 15.3 points per game.
